Transaction f51b34c27ed0949e00cc3d4f09bc4cd386525bf7255b78da396293423fe91304
1 Input
2 Outputs
- f51b34c27ed0949e00cc3d4f09bc4cd386525bf7255b78da396293423fe91304:0
- f51b34c27ed0949e00cc3d4f09bc4cd386525bf7255b78da396293423fe91304:1
value 53040000
address 12cipcrc76fJzPdp2LkCDgckmesr5Q1P5R
value 500000
address 14HSrAb53FFzVVeKzB3SLmozxzG953K1NT